FAQ

What exactly is a cultivation game and why are they so popular?

Cultivation games pull you into a world inspired by Chinese xianxia tales, where ordinary mortals train their spirit, body, and mind to reach immortality. You’ll gather qi, break through realms, and learn supernatural arts. Their charm lies in the sheer depth of character growth and the feeling of gradually becoming a legendary being, mixing philosophy, martial arts, and magic in a way Western fantasy often doesn’t.

Can you recommend some standout Chinese cultivation games from recent years?

Definitely. Amazing Cultivation Simulator turns the genre into a deep colony sim with heavy feng shui mechanics. Tale of Immortal is a sandbox RPG where the world reacts to your choices, and Gujian 3 delivers a polished action-RPG with gorgeous mythology. For something gentler, Immortal Life blends farming and cultivation in a cozy package.

Are these games suitable for players new to the xianxia genre?

They’re surprisingly welcoming. Most modern titles ease you in with tutorials and early quest lines that explain concepts like qi circulation or tribulation without info-dumping. The core loop—improve skills, craft gear, uncover secrets—clicks quickly even if you’ve never heard of a “golden core” before.

Which cultivation game offers the most freedom to roam and explore?

Tale of Immortal stands out for its open-ended world. You can disregard the main story entirely, wander through procedural regions, challenge bandits, join a sect, or build a network of allies and rivals. It feels less like a curated journey and more like your own martial arts legend unfolding.

Do these games focus more on action combat or peaceful meditation and crafting?

It’s a spectrum. Titles like Sword and Fairy 7 emphasize cinematic real-time battles, while Amazing Cultivation Simulator has you designing harmonious sect layouts and meditating on dao insights. Many games blend both—you might spend an afternoon perfecting an alchemy recipe, then test your new pill’s buffs in a boss fight.

Is it possible to experience ascending to immortality in any of these titles?

Absolutely, and it’s often the climax. In Amazing Cultivation Simulator, guiding your disciples through breakthroughs until they ascend is the main goal, complete with heavenly tribulations. Tale of Immortal also lets you push your character toward transcendence, facing trials that can obliterate you if you’re unprepared—making the achievement feel earned.
